This handbook encapsulates much of BRE's expertise relating to the design of housing, and is addressed to all owners, designers and maintainers of housing stock. It provides a reference manual of basic information on housing, whether new or refurbished. It is intended to help clients, contractors, developers and all involved in housebuilding, in both the private and public sectors, to appreciate the wide range of user requirements that must be addressed in the design of housing. As a reference book it provides a means of checking that housing design criteria have been met adequately. It also suggests how to achieve customer satisfaction by meeting their most important needs.
